With the development of modern technology, higher image quality is required in more aspects of life. In order to meet the requirement of application, people tend to work on certain algorithms with the purpose of achieving high quality image instead of improving the device with high costs. Research on image super-resolution recon- struction (SRR), which is an image-enhancing approach aiming to reconstruct a high-resolution (HR) image from observed multiple low-resolution (LR) images, has been done recently. Nowadays, SRR techniques have been widely used in many aspects of life.As an efficient set of techniques in signal processing, wavelet transform enjoys good local features in both time domain and frequency domain of signal representation. Accordingly, the multi-scale analysis tools, which enjoy better quality, have been developed. Scholars have already put forth algorithms on wavelet-based SRR, and have achieved good performance in signal construction. Inspired by the ideas above, this paper introduces the multi-scale analysis tools into SRR technique, and more specifically describing, investigates the SRR algorithms based on Contourlet transform.The main work related includes the contents as follows:(1) A SSR method for single-frame image is proposed, which is based on Contourlet transform combined with Soft-decision adaptive interpolation (SAI) algorithm. The algorithm takes advantage of edge and detail capture features via Contourlet transform and details preserving ability in enhancement via SAI. Experimental simulation indicates that the proposed algorithm boosts quite good performance. And then, based on the analysis of the method above, an improved algorithm is proposed, with feasibility proof via experimental results.(2) A SSR method for sequential images is proposed in the paper, which is based on Contourlet transform combined with Projection Onto Convex Set (POCS) algorithm. POCS algorithm is classical in sequential image reconstruction techniques, whose advantage is that the prior information of images could be easily added and the edges and details of HR-images could be well preserved as well. Compared with other algorithms, it is shown via experiment that the proposed algorithm boosts both better subjective visual quality and higher PSNR values.(3) A SSR method for sequential image is proposed in the paper, which is based on Contourlet transform combined with image fusion technique. Image fusion is to synthesize images of a special scene captured by two or more sensors, and generate a new description of the scene, with the aim to reduce the uncertainty of images and improve the definition through information complement of several images. Based on it, the proposed algorithm is finished with Contourlet transform. Compared with other algorithms, experimental simulation shows its rationality and feasibility.
